What Is A Tieback Anchor?

A tieback anchor or helical tieback anchor is a small grouted anchor composed of a steel shaft and round helix plates. The primary use for tieback anchors is to reinforce foundation and retaining walls for lateral stability. When the tieback anchor is properly installed it will pull a bowing wall into its correct position and help prevent any future shifting or bowing.

The success of helical tieback anchors is based on decades of use of similar anchors by electric utilities. They are installed with rotary drilling equipment, where the anchor is rotated into the ground, similar to a screw into wood. The other end of the tieback is secured into the wall. This helps keep the wall from bowing or leaning.

Helical Tieback Anchor Applications

Using helical tieback anchors is an ideal choice for applications, such as:

  • Seawalls
  • Basement walls
  • Retaining walls
  • Shoring
  • Temporary wall support
  • Tilt-up construction

 

What Advantages Do Helical Tieback Anchors Offer?

Using proven methods from decades of similar anchors, helical tieback anchors offer a wide variety of advantages, such as:

  • Testable load capacity
  • Can be installed into tight spaces
  • Clean installation process
  • Minimizes labor costs
  • Predictable capacity
  • Can be installed in any weather
